As an assistant or associate professor accounting, you will be part of the accounting group of the Department of Economics and Business Economics at the Nijmegen School of Management (NSM) .
Accounting at NSM is Accounting+. It all starts from the premise that Accounting is an active agent in a dynamic and evolving social world. Accounting+@NSM thus focuses on the grand societal challenges of our times, embraces their interdisciplinary context, recognizes their conceptual complexity, and aims at identifying actionable outcomes. The Accounting+ approach of the accounting group at NSM is evidenced in the full breadth of its activities related to teaching, research, and social impact activities.
This position includes both research and teaching. You will be expected to conduct high-quality and original research in line with the above Accounting+ profile. Preferably, you will show an interest in the relationships between accounting and sustainability, and accounting and artificial intelligence (AI). Further potential topics include, but are not limited to, accounting information systems (AIS), auditing of financial and non-financial information, and behavioural accounting. This position is expected to result in a series of high-quality publications. The Nijmegen School of Management explicitly encourages interdisciplinary research in which accounting is studied from various perspectives, including philosophy of mind and action and neuroscience. You will further be expected to provide high-quality courses in accounting and economics at the Bachelor’s and Master’s levels, and to supervise Bachelor’s and Master’s theses.

The department of Economics and Business Economics consists of five theme groups: Accounting, Finance, Economic Theory and Policy, International Economics, and Developmental Economics. The department is responsible for the development and quality of the Bachelor’s and Master’s programmes in Economics, as well as for courses in Economics in other educational programmes offered by NSM. What sets the Nijmegen curriculum in Economics apart is that it is characterised by a multidisciplinary approach, whereby in addition to the economics discipline, inspiration is sought from other areas.
